win10下安装vmware workstation,并安装ubuntu18.04虚拟机。后续介绍了安装Ubuntu之后的常用软件安装与配置…

win10下虚拟机安装ubuntu

虚拟机安装

虚拟机vmware workstations中文官方下载地址:VMware-workstation
选择对应的版本。下载完成后开始安装,

1.png

点击下一步,

2.png

勾选“我接受许可协议中的条款”,一直点击下一步,知道输入许可证,点击,可选择输入:

1
2
YC74H-FGF92-081VZ-R5QNG-P6RY4
YC34H-6WWDK-085MQ-JYPNX-NZRA2

点击完成。

虚拟机安装ubuntu

首先官网下载ubuntu

打开虚拟机,点击创建新的虚拟机,

avtar

选择自定义(高级),下一步即可,

avtar

一直点击下一步,选择 稍后安装操作系统,

avtar

保持默认设置,下一步,

avtar

设置虚拟机名字,以及保存位置,可使用默认,下一步

avtar

后面是内存等的配置,根据电脑需求配置,保持默认也可以。

直到此处,选择网络类型

  • 桥接模式:是会占用宿主计算机所处的网络环境中的IP地址的,虽然他会占用IP地址,但是可以和同网络环境下的设备进行相互通信。

  • NAT模式:该方式不会占用宿主计算机所处网络环境中的IP地址,他会在宿主计算机中虚拟出一个网络环境,给宿主计算机和虚拟机各分配一个IP地址,也就是说这时的宿主计算机是有两个IP地址的,一个是宿主计算机所处的网络环境中的IP地址,一个是和虚拟机构建的虚拟网络环境中的IP地址,这种方式下,虚拟机可以通过宿主计算机的网络代理访问外界资源,但是外界设备不能访问宿主计算机中的虚拟机。

  • 主机模式:这种网络方式,虚拟机只能和宿主计算机进行通信,而不能访问外界设备,更不用说占用IP地址资源了。
    比较常用的是桥接和NAT模式,这里我选择NAT模式.

avtar

保持默认设置,以下选择创建新虚拟磁盘,

avtar

存储内存分配,不小于默认分配即可,可以根据需要增加,(拆分与不拆分区别:如果以后要移动这个虚拟机,选择拆分。不移动,选择不拆分)

avtar

点击完成

avtar

avtar

双击CD/DVD(SATA),选择“使用ISO映像文件“,找到下载好的ubuntu系统,确定

avtar

开启此虚拟机。

可选择中文,或保留默认,点击Install Ubuntu,

avtar

根据需求选择或保持默认

使用LVM,

avtar

Install Now, continue,

avtar

设置用户名与密码,

avtar

等待完成安装,

avtar

重启

安装后事项

问题:界面小,不适应屏幕

解决:安装vmware-tools。

选择菜单栏中虚拟机->安装vmware-tools,找到相应的压缩文件,解压,并运行:

1
sudo ./vmware-install.pl

avtar

重启后,可实现ubuntu与windows之间的粘贴复制。

更新源

  • 设置software update,为China->mirror.aliyun***
    1
    2
    sudo apt-get update
    sudp apt-get upgrade

中文输入法

  1. 输入:

    1
    sudo apt install ibus-pinyin
  2. 打开Setting->Region&Language->Manage Installed Languages

    Keyboard input method system。ibus对应 IBus,fcitx对应XIM。

    然后,点击Install / Remove Languages… 选择安装中文简体:

    avtar

    点击+号添加输入法:

    avtar

其他安装

  • 网络工具:
    1
    2
    sudo apt install net-tools
    ifconfig -a # 查看网络IP

安装git

1
sudo apt install git

配置部分参考对应章节。

  • 安装oh my zsh

  • 安装VSCode,官网下载对应的安装包即可;

  • 配置git账户等

安装编译器

1
sudo apt install gcc g++ cmake